Global Farmer0;448;0;145;0;1c4d; is a top-down strategic management simulator that officially transitioned from Early Access to a full release on August 14, 2025. Developed by Thera Bytes GmbH0;80;0;1df; and published by Aerosoft GmbH, it distinguishes itself from traditional vehicle-centric sims like Farming Simulator by focusing on broad-scale business strategy and real-world data integration. 0;92;0;a3; 0;baf;0;da; Core Gameplay & Features
The game’s standout mechanic is its "Farm the World" system, which utilizes OpenStreetMap data to let players establish a farm in virtually any real-world location. 0;381;0;450;
Global Mapping: You can pinpoint specific locations, such as your own neighborhood, and the game generates terrain based on that area's actual soil composition and weather patterns.
Strategic Management0;48c;: Instead of driving individual tractors, you manage a fleet of machinery and a team of workers to execute complex crop rotations.
Dynamic Resources: Success depends on monitoring soil pH values, nutrient levels, and seasonal temperature requirements for over 26 different crop types.
Economic Strategy0;d2;: Players navigate a dynamic marketplace with fluctuating prices and can take on specific contracts to increase revenue. System Requirements

The Problem with Traditional Food Distribution
Traditional food distribution systems are often lengthy, complex, and wasteful. Produce typically travels from farms to processing facilities, then to wholesalers, and finally to retailers, often taking several days to weeks to reach consumers. This lengthy journey results in:
- Food waste: Up to 30% of produce is lost or wasted during transportation, handling, and storage.
- Reduced nutritional value: Fresh produce loses its nutritional value over time, making it less healthy for consumers.
- Higher costs: The multiple intermediaries in the traditional distribution system drive up costs, making fresh produce more expensive for consumers.
The Rise of Global Farm-to-Table
Global Farm-to-Table is a new approach to food distribution that leverages technology, logistics, and collaboration to get fresh produce from farms to tables faster, more efficiently, and with minimal waste. This innovative approach involves:
- Direct-to-consumer sales: Farmers sell their produce directly to consumers, either through online platforms, farmers' markets, or community-supported agriculture (CSA) programs.
- Streamlined logistics: Advanced logistics and transportation systems ensure that produce is moved quickly and efficiently from farms to consumers.
- Digital marketplaces: Online platforms connect farmers, consumers, and logistics providers, making it easier to buy, sell, and transport fresh produce.

While torrenting itself is a legal peer-to-peer file transfer protocol, using it to download copyrighted games for free is illegal and highly dangerous. 1. High Risk of Malware and Ransomware
Files found on unverified torrent sites often contain malicious code. Because early access games are frequently updated, "cracked" versions may require users to disable antivirus software to run, leaving their system defenseless against: Banking Trojans: Designed to steal your financial details.
Ransomware: Which can lock your entire computer and demand payment for its release.
Cryptominers: These run in the background, using your CPU/GPU power to mine cryptocurrency for hackers, which can damage your hardware. 2. Privacy Exposure
Torrenting works by sharing file "pieces" with other users. During this process, your IP address is publicly visible to everyone else in the "swarm," including hackers and copyright enforcement agencies. 3. Broken Gameplay and Crashes Global Farmer - is it Worth Playing?
